In a clip that never aired on Friday’s WWE SmackDown, Cody Rhodes took a hard line against Randy Orton. The footage, surfaced by Wrestling Headlines, shows Rhodes refusing to strike an injured Orton during a Saturday Night’s Main Event match, a decision that cost him the bout and sparked a heated exchange.

Impact on the Match Outcome
Rhodes hesitated when he had the chance to deliver a head kick to the wounded Orton. That pause allowed Orton to counter with an RKO, turning the tide and securing the win. The moment underscores how split-second decisions can alter a storyline’s direction.
